The creator provides several updates regarding the cruise industry, covering ship delays, cancellations, and fleet changes. One segment discusses an investigation into Royal Caribbean's Harmony of the Seas, which reportedly entered a no sail zone that interfered with a SpaceX rocket launch from Port Canaveral. Regarding Norwegian Cruise Line, the creator notes that the company has extended the expiration date for future cruise credits to December 31, 2022. In Brazil, cruising has been delayed until February 18, 2022, due to government restrictions. The creator also reports that the Disney Wish is facing delays due to shipyard issues in Germany caused by the Omicron variant, with sailings now expected to begin in July 2022. Finally, the video addresses the departure of two classic Carnival ships, the Carnival Ecstasy and the Carnival Sensation, noting that the Sensation will not return to service.
